Allan Fredric Brimhall, 59, a senior minister, died Saturday, May 13, 2000, at his home in West Melbourne, Fla. He was formerly an Idyllwild resident.

Mr. Brimhall was born in Tucson, Ariz., and lived in Idyllwild for several years where he worked for Village Properties. He also took several classes with the Rev. Betty Jandl of the Idyllwild Church of Religious Science toward his own ministry.

Mr. Brimhall moved to Florida in 1995 and became minister of the Melbourne Church of Religious Science. There, he also served on the Board of Directors of Project Response.

Memorial services will be at 3 p.m. Monday, May 29, 2000, at the Idyllwild Church of Religious Science.

Survivors include his companion, John Loetterle of West Melbourne; a daughter, Michelle Brewer of Clay Springs, Ariz.; four sons, Craig Brimhall of San Antonio, Brian and David Brimhall, both of Flagstaff, Ariz., and Mars Brimhall of Monument, Colo.; his parents, Logan and Catherine Brimhall of Wellton, Ariz.; a brother, Arthur Brimhall of Lake Havasu, Ariz.; five sisters, Judith Hilleary of Apple Valley, Elaine Kohler of Sulpher, La., Doris Rubio of Phoenix, Andrea Benson of Santa Ana and Irene Sullivan of Puma, Ariz.; and 11 grandchildren.
